Can friesan horses make good jumpers?

As a general rule, no. Friesian were originally bred to pull carriages and then to carry knights into battle. They are more suited to harness and flatwork. However to keep them fit you can ask them to go over low jumps.

What is the name of a draft animal?

A draft animal is one that is used by humans to provide transportation and do work. In the United States the most common draft animal is a horse, of which there are many breeds that have been bred for draft work. Common examples of draft horses include the Clydesdale (the Budweiser horses), Friesan and Percheron. In other parts of the world local populations use oxen, water buffalo and elephants as draft animals.
